>>> +    E = \(kmalloc@kok\|kzalloc@kok\|krealloc@kok\|kcalloc@kok\|kmalloc_node@kok\|kzalloc_node@kok\|kmalloc_array@kok\|kmalloc_array_node@kok\|kcalloc_node@kok\)(...)
>>
>> I would prefer an other coding style here.
>>
>> * Items for such SmPL disjunctions can be specified also on multiple lines.
>>
>> * The semantic patch language supports further means to handle function name lists
>>   in more convenient ways.
>>   Would you like to work with customised constraints?
>
> Please don't follow this advice.

I have got recurring understanding difficulties with such a response.
Will quoted patch review issues clarified in any other ways?


> Coccinelle is not able to optimize its search process according to
> the information in constraints.  It will needlessly parse many files.
